Before You Start: What You'll Need

Before creating your OnlyFans account, gather these essentials:

Required Documents

  • Government-issued ID: Passport, driver's licence, or national ID card
  • Selfie for verification: A clear photo of you holding your ID
  • Bank account or payment method: For receiving your earnings
  • Recommended Preparation

  • Content backlog: 10-20 pieces of content ready to post
  • Profile photo and banner: High-quality, eye-catching images
  • Bio and description: Written and ready to paste
  • Social media accounts: For promotion (can be new accounts with a stage name)
  • Step 1: Create Your Account

    Sign Up Process

  • 1. Go to OnlyFans.com and click "Sign Up"
  • 2. Enter your email address
  • 3. Create a strong password
  • 4. Verify your email
  • Choose Your Username

    Your username becomes your URL (onlyfans.com/yourusername). Choose wisely:

      Do:
    • Keep it short and memorable
    • Make it easy to spell
    • Use your stage name if you have one
    • Consider SEO (what people might search for)
      Don't:
    • Use your real name (unless intentional)
    • Make it hard to spell or remember
    • Use numbers/symbols unnecessarily
    • Copy another creator's name

    Step 2: Complete Verification

    OnlyFans requires identity verification for all creators. This protects both you and the platform.

    Verification Steps

  • 1. Upload a photo of your ID (front and back if applicable)
  • 2. Take a selfie holding your ID
  • 3. Ensure lighting is clear and all text is readable
  • 4. Submit and wait for approval (usually 24-72 hours)
  • Privacy Note

    Your legal name appears on verification but isn't visible to subscribers. They only see your chosen display name.

    Step 3: Set Up Your Profile

    Profile Photo

  • High-quality image (your face or representative image)
  • Eye-catching but platform-appropriate
  • Consistent with your brand across platforms
  • Cover/Banner Image

  • Larger image displayed at the top of your profile
  • Sets the tone for your content
  • Can include text about what subscribers get
  • Bio/Description

      Write a compelling bio that:
    • Explains what content you offer
    • Sets expectations for subscribers
    • Includes posting frequency
    • Has personality that matches your brand

    Example structure: "Welcome to my page! I post [content type] [frequency]. Subscribe for [key benefits]. Message me for custom content. 💕"

    Step 4: Configure Your Settings

    Subscription Price

    This is the monthly fee subscribers pay. Consider:

      Free Page (£0):
    • Maximises subscriber count
    • Relies on PPV and tips for income
    • Good for building audience, then upselling
      Low Price (£3-10):
    • Low barrier to entry
    • Attracts more subscribers
    • Need higher volume for significant income
      Medium Price (£10-25):
    • Balance of volume and value
    • Most common starting range
    • Allows room to run sales
      Premium Price (£25-50+):
    • Fewer subscribers but higher value each
    • Requires strong existing audience
    • Sets premium expectations

    Our recommendation: Start at £10-15, then adjust based on results.

    Subscription Bundles

      Offer discounts for longer commitments:
    • 3 months: 10-15% off
    • 6 months: 20-25% off
    • 12 months: 30-40% off

    Bundles increase subscriber lifetime value significantly.

    Other Settings

  • Location: Can be hidden or generalised
  • Amazon wishlist: Optional, allows fans to buy you gifts
  • Watermark: Protects your content from theft
  • Step 5: Create Your Content Library

    Before promoting, have content ready. Subscribers expect value immediately.

    Minimum Starting Content

  • 10-20 posts minimum before launch
  • Mix of photos and videos
  • Variety in content types
  • Set the tone for what subscribers can expect
  • Content Categories

      Free content (visible before subscribing):
    • Teaser posts that show your style
    • SFW or mildly suggestive content
    • Enough to entice but not give everything away
      Subscription content:
    • Your main feed posts
    • Regular, consistent quality
    • What subscribers are paying for
      PPV content:
    • Premium content for additional purchase
    • More explicit or special content
    • Higher production value or personalisation

    Step 6: Plan Your Posting Schedule

    Consistency matters more than volume. Choose a sustainable schedule:

    Beginner Schedule

  • 3-5 posts per week
  • 1-2 stories/updates daily
  • Response to messages within 24 hours
  • Established Schedule

  • Daily posts
  • Multiple story updates
  • Same-day message responses
  • Weekly live streams
  • Best Posting Times

      General guidelines (adjust for your audience):
    • Evenings (7-10pm) in your target market
    • Weekends often perform well
    • Consistent timing helps subscribers anticipate content

    Step 7: Promotion Strategy

    OnlyFans has no discovery feature. You must drive your own traffic.

    Twitter/X

  • Most OnlyFans-friendly mainstream platform
  • Create a dedicated creator account
  • Post teasers with links to your page
  • Engage with other creators and fans
  • Reddit

  • Find relevant subreddits for your niche
  • Follow each subreddit's rules carefully
  • Provide value, don't just spam links
  • Build karma before promoting
  • Instagram/TikTok

  • More restrictive on adult content
  • Focus on personality and lifestyle content
  • Use linktree or similar for bio links
  • Be creative to avoid content removal

  • Step 8: Engaging Your Subscribers

    Welcome Messages

      Set up automated welcome messages for new subscribers:
    • Thank them for subscribing
    • Set expectations
    • Offer PPV or upsells
    • Encourage engagement

    Ongoing Engagement

  • Respond to comments and messages
  • Create polls to understand preferences
  • Run occasional promotions
  • Remember regular supporters
  • Common Mistakes to Avoid

    1. Launching Too Early

    Don't promote until you have content ready. First impressions matter.

    2. Pricing Too Low

    You can always offer sales, but raising base prices is harder.

    3. Inconsistent Posting

    Subscribers who feel neglected will cancel.

    4. Ignoring Messages

    Fan engagement drives retention and PPV sales.

    5. No Promotion

    Great content means nothing if no one sees it.
